The last 5% feels like the least professional 5%

You spent weeks -- sometimes months -- crafting something exceptional. Then it ends with a Dropbox link and a "let me know if you have questions." Your clients are left guessing how to use what they paid for.

  • 📦

    Deliverables land with a thud

    Clients receive a zip file with no context, no structure guide, and no idea which files are final versus working drafts. Two weeks later they send a support request asking for "the original PSD."

  • 🔧

    Maintenance falls through the cracks

    Nobody writes down who handles plugin updates, certificate renewals, or what the monthly CMS backup routine looks like. Six months later, something breaks and you hear about it from a frustrated client.

  • 🤝

    The referral moment slips away

    The best time to earn a referral is when the client is most impressed -- right at handoff. A rushed, forgettable close kills that momentum. A polished package keeps it alive and gives them something to show others.

  • Documentation eats the hours you won't bill

    You know you should write proper handoff docs. Most freelancers skip it because it takes 3-4 hours they do not want to write off on a project that is already closing out.

Six documents. One professional close.

Every Relay package includes six core deliverable documents, each generated and formatted specifically for your project and calibrated to your client's level of technical fluency.

📋

Asset Inventory

A structured, categorized list of every deliverable file -- source files, exports, fonts, photography, icons, and documents -- with folder location, version notes, and format description. Eliminates the "where's the original?" question permanently.

All Plans
📁

File Structure Guide

A visual map of the project folder structure with plain-language annotations explaining what each folder contains and which files are final versus in-progress. Designed so non-technical clients can navigate their own deliverable folder with confidence.

All Plans
📖

Usage and Style Guide

Step-by-step instructions for how to use the delivered product day to day: how to update content, apply the brand correctly, log into the CMS, resize images, or make common changes without breaking anything. Dramatically reduces first-month support tickets.

All Plans
🔄

Maintenance Schedule

A quarterly calendar of recommended maintenance tasks -- software updates, security audits, backup verification, license renewals -- with checkboxes and time estimates. Calibrated to your specific tech stack. Clients love having a plan, and it opens the door for a natural retainer conversation.

All Plans
📝

Support Terms Summary

A clear, professional statement of what is included in post-launch support: what you cover, what falls outside scope, response time expectations, and how to submit change requests. Sets professional boundaries without reading like boilerplate legalese.

Pro & Agency
🎨

Brand Reference Sheet

For brand and web design projects: a one-page visual summary of all brand decisions -- hex codes, typeface pairings, spacing principles, logo usage rules, and voice notes. The document clients actually keep on their desktop and share with future vendors.
